      Victoria's home form this season in the Brazilian Serie A has been outstanding. In 9 home games, they've achieved 7 wins, 1 draw, and 1 loss. Their home goal difference stands at an impressive +12, conceding only 3 goals. This shows their high - level defensive efficiency, ranking among the top in the league. With an average of 1.67 goals scored and 0.33 goals conceded per home game, they've demonstrated a strong home - field dominance. However, their away form is a complete disaster. In 11 away games, they've failed to secure a single win, with 4 draws and 7 losses. They've conceded 24 goals and have a goal difference of - 17. Their away win rate is a mere 0.0%, presenting a stark contrast to their home performance. Looking at their recent form, in the last 6 games, Victoria's win rate is 33.3%, with a goals - for - against ratio of 4:7.       Palmeiras holds a significant tactical edge over Vitória based on their past head - to - head encounters. In the 10 official meetings, Palmeiras has a record of 6 wins, 2 draws, and 2 losses. Looking at the home - away breakdown, Palmeiras achieved 4 wins, 1 draw, and 1 loss at home, and 2 wins, 1 draw, and 1 loss on the road. The most recent clash saw Palmeiras thrash Vitória 5 - 1 at home, leading 3 - 0 at halftime and having a 6 - 4 lead in corner kicks, which clearly demonstrated their dominance on that day. However, Vitória has shown solidity at home. In one match, they defeated Palmeiras 2 - 0, with a staggering 13 - 2 corner - kick difference, indicating their efficient home - ground offense and defense. On the other hand, Palmeiras has a strong away - game attacking performance.
